Chapter 332—The Universe is Waiting
Go out into the highways and hedges, and compel them to come in,
that my house may be filled.
Luke 14:23
.
In this speck of a world the whole heavenly universe manifests the
greatest interest, for Christ has paid an infinite price for the souls of its
inhabitants.
Everything in the universe calls upon those who know the truth to
consecrate themselves unreservedly to the proclamation of the truth as it has
been made known to them in the third angel’s message.... The working of
satanic agencies calls every Christian to stand in his lot.
The work given us is a great and important one, and in it are needed
wise, unselfish men, men who understand what it means to give themselves
to unselfish effort to save souls. But there is no need for the service of men
who are lukewarm, for such men Christ cannot use. Men and women are
needed whose hearts are touched with human suffering and whose lives give
evidence that they are receiving and imparting light and life and grace.
The people of God are to come close to Christ in self-denial and sacrifice,
their one aim being to give the message of mercy to all the world. Some will
work in one way and some in another, as the Lord shall call and lead them.
But they are all to strive together, seeking to make the work a perfect whole.
The church will not retrograde while the members seek help from the
throne of grace, that they may not fail to cooperate in the great work of
saving the souls that are on the brink of ruin....
The heavenly universe is waiting for consecrated channels, through which
God can communicate with His people, and through them with the world.
God will work through a consecrated, self-denying church, and He will
reveal His Spirit in a visible and glorious manner, especially in this time,
when Satan is working in a masterly manner to deceive the souls of both
ministers and people....
Will not the church awake to her responsibility? God is waiting to impart
the Spirit of the greatest missionary the world has ever known to those who
will work with self-denying, self-sacrificing consecration.
